Spermoderm Definition

noun

(botany) A seed coat or testa.

Wiktionary

Other Word Forms of Spermoderm

Noun

Singular:
spermoderm
Plural:
spermoderms

Find Similar Words

Find similar words to spermoderm using the buttons below.

Words Starting With

Words Ending With

Unscrambles

spermoderm